Overall, Ozark County is an outdoor lover's paradise. From hiking and fishing to kayaking and swimming, there's no shortage of activities to keep you busy during your stay. Some of our favorite outdoor attractions include the Mark Twain National Forest, the North Fork River, and the Caney Mountain Conservation Area.
Exploring the Local Culture
In addition to its natural beauty, Ozark County is also home to a rich local culture that's worth exploring. One of the best ways to experience this culture is by visiting some of the area's historic sites, such as the Dawt Mill and the Ozark County Courthouse.

What are some must-see attractions in Ozark County?
Some of the must-see attractions in Ozark County include the Mark Twain National Forest, the North Fork River, and the Dawt Mill. Additionally, be sure to explore some of the area's charming small towns, such as Gainesville and Theodosia.
